| In the framework of the Muon Group, our common activities are devoted to COMET and g-2/EDM, searching for a charged lepton flavor violating process of muon to electron conversion and physics precision measurements constraining new physics beyond the Standard Model. Silicon microstrip (g-2/EDM) and pixel (COMET) detectors need detailed studies,including the associated GEANT4, mechanical and thermal simulations and the tracking developed within ICEDUST, the new COMET Software Framework. A common software project concerns also a possible implementation of ICEDUST in the g-2/EDM Software Framework.
